Redefining Power: The Multitude and Global Capital

This chapter examines the evolving dynamics of globalism and the relevance of the nation-state in an age dominated by free-flowing capital. It discusses the concept of the 'multitude' as a counterforce to global capital, contrasting traditional political identities with contemporary forms of resistance. The analysis reflects on historical perspectives while critiquing the limitations of current power structures and the imperative for innovative democratic approaches.
